Practical Tips for Boosting Your Energy Today
Even if energy medicine feels unfamiliar, you can start incorporating these principles into your daily life:
Grounding: Spend time barefoot on the earth to reconnect with its natural electromagnetic field.
Breathwork: Deep breathing exercises enhance oxygen delivery to your cells, optimizing energy production.
Optimize Sleep Hygiene: Quality sleep is critical for cellular repair and energetic renewal.
Mind-Body Practices: Yoga, Tai Chi, and Qi Gong align your physical and energetic systems for improved vitality.
Energy-Boosting Nutrition: Foods rich in antioxidants, healthy fats, and clean proteins support mitochondrial health and energy production.
